Output 31e74cfd065b4827a07266d2de46a4a25ea458cda31e304bd5bf227777ecedf6:0

value
6985230331733
script pubkey
OP_0 OP_PUSHBYTES_20 3c627bb763ba9174dce5b2e6228747ca7dc1aa88
address
tb1q8338hdmrh2ghfh89ktnz9p68ef7ur25g9pkjjt
transaction
31e74cfd065b4827a07266d2de46a4a25ea458cda31e304bd5bf227777ecedf6
confirmations
192847
spent
true